About This Location

Vanderbilt Health Walk-In Clinic - Hendersonville is part of Vanderbilt Health — the clinical network of Vanderbilt University Medical Center (VUMC), the Nashville region's premier academic medical center and Level I trauma center, consistently ranked among the nation's best hospitals by U.S. News & World Report. VUMC operates Vanderbilt University Hospital, Monroe Carell Jr. Children's Hospital at Vanderbilt, and the Vanderbilt Health Affiliated Network of primary care, specialty care, and urgent care clinics across Middle Tennessee. Services include walk-in urgent care for minor injuries, respiratory illness, UTIs, rashes, lacerations, sprains, and allergic reactions, with on-site digital X-ray, lab testing, COVID/flu testing, and sports physicals. Most major commercial insurance plans, Medicare, TennCare (Tennessee Medicaid), and Tricare are accepted. Located in Hendersonville, the clinic operates 7:30 AM – 7:30 PM on weekdays. Patients have direct referral access into the full VUMC academic medical system.

About Hendersonville

Hendersonville is a Sumner County city of about 62,000 on Old Hickory Lake north of Nashville along US-31E and SR-386. Known as a family-friendly lakeside community, historically the home of country music legends (Johnny Cash and June Carter Cash lived here), and now a rapidly growing suburb with excellent Sumner County schools. TriStar Hendersonville Medical Center is the local hospital anchor.
